itisnotclearwhencechaucerderivedthistale.tyrwhittthinksitwastakenfromthestoryofflorent,inthefirstbookofgowers"confessioamantis;"orperhapsfromanoldernarrativefromwhichgowerhimselfborrowed.chaucerhascondensedandotherwiseimprovedthefable,especiallybylayingthescene,notinsicily,butatthecourtofourownkingarthur.
